mysql 授权命令 mysql授予权限失败

导读:MySQL是一款流行的关系型数据库管理系统,它允许用户授予不同级别的权限以保护数据库的安全 。然而,在实践中,有时会遇到授予权限失败的情况 , 本文将介绍可能的原因和解决方法 。
1. 检查语法错误:在授予权限时,语法错误是最常见的问题之一 。请确保您的命令正确无误,并且所有关键字、表名和列名都正确拼写 。
2. 检查用户是否存在:如果您尝试为不存在的用户授予权限,那么命令肯定会失败 。请先创建该用户 , 然后再授予权限 。
3. 检查权限级别:MySQL允许用户授予不同级别的权限,如SELECT、INSERT、UPDATE和DELETE等 。如果您尝试授予超出自己权限级别的权限,那么命令也会失败 。
4. 检查IP地址或主机名:如果您尝试从另一个IP地址或主机名连接到MySQL服务器,那么您需要为该IP地址或主机名授予相应的权限 。否则 , 您将无法连接到服务器并执行命令 。
5. 检查MySQL版本:某些MySQL版本可能会限制某些操作,例如GRANT命令 。请确保您的MySQL版本支持您想要执行的操作 。
【mysql 授权命令 mysql授予权限失败】总结:MySQL授予权限失败可能是由于语法错误、用户不存在、权限级别、IP地址或主机名以及MySQL版本等原因导致的 。通过仔细检查这些问题,您可以解决大部分授予权限失败的情况 。

    推荐阅读